We have indeed, sent down to you the Koran, a (clear) sending, 23 So persevere with the command of your Lord and do not pay any heed to the wicked and the unbelieving, 24 And remember the name of your Lord morning and evening. 25 and prostrate yourself before Him at night, and extol His Glory during the long watches of the night. 26 Indeed these people love what they have, the fleeting one, and have forsaken the immensely important day behind them. 27 It is We Who created them, and We have made their joints strong; but, when We will, We can substitute the like of them by a complete change. 28 This is indeed an advice; so whoever wishes may take the path towards his Lord. 29 And you do not will except that Allah wills. Indeed, Allah is ever Knowing and Wise. 30 He makes whom He pleases to enter into His mercy; and (as for) the unjust, He has prepared for them a painful chastisement. 31
Almighty God's Truth.
End of Surah: The Human (Al-Insan). Sent down in Medina after The All Compassionate (Al-Rahman) before Divorce (Al-Talaaq)
